NEW Great way to hold helium balloons on the ground – Shaped biscuit balloon weights

Create a shaped cookie – cover it in icing and 100 and thousand, make a whole through the cookie and put the balloon ribbon through and there you have a cookie balloon weight – that is multi purposed – great for treats for the little ones and holds the helium balloon on the ground.

 
 

Home Karaoke Machines Shopping Guide – Facts You Must Know

30 Sep

First you have probably been to a lot of karaoke bars and parties and noticed the difference in the music. If you are becoming a karaoke fan you have probably inquired into this, and found out it has to do with the different companies that produce the discs.

Being as the background music isn’t the original artists, this is where the difference comes in. Now when it comes time to purchase your karaoke machine you are going to have to decide on the type of discs you are going to play. You are going to be faced with a choice as some handle CDGs or CD+G or just plain karaoke song DVDs.

You need to familiarize yourself with the advantages and disadvantage of these, when you are making your decision. Actually some with have built in music while others use Mp3s. Check around with your friends who have karaoke machines and see what type of discs they play. If you find a variety of them to check out, it will help you choose which method you like the most.

Features are another issue that is going to be important to you and a lot will depend on what you are going to be using it form. Sort of keep an open mind here, because you may have intentions for using it for one thing, then down the road start adding other uses to it. For example you may initially be buying so you can practice your own singing on. If that’s the case then there are many features you are not going to need. But then 6 months down the road you might start having karaoke parties, then the other type features you are going to need.

You need to decide whether you want to be able to turn vocals on or off. Some of the music you buy may contain vocal for you to practice with then as you get better you can turn the vocal off. Your karaoke machine must have the option to do that. Of course you are going to want volume control. When it comes to microphones you are going to have to choose between wired or wireless, or even headset microphones. The price range of these vary, so that will be another deciding factor as well. Then there are things like being able to score the singer. Some karaoke machines have that capability built right into there.

Then it will come down to style and whether you are going to leave your machine at home all the time, or do you want to travel around with it. If its going to be a home unit you may want to look at a system that you can integrate with your home stereo systems. Then on the other hand, you may want to set it up in a separate area, so you will want a stand alone system. The draw back with this system is it can be quite bulky and take up a fair amount of room..

Then there are extras that you can add to it later on such as karaoke stands, which there are a variety of as well. If you are going to travel with it ,you will want to protect it as much as possible, so you may want to have some kind of carriers for your speakers. Also don’t forget to protect your discs as much as possible.

Ghosts are probably the most common spooky creature associate with printable Halloween invitations and the holiday itself. Originally, the holiday was celebrated by the Celts who viewed it as a time when the barriers between the worlds of the living and of the dead became easier to cross. The dead re-entered the living world either to torment or to visit with the living. But ghosts preceded the creation of free printable Halloween invitations by many centuries. One of the first recorded mentions of ghosts was in ancient China. After King Hsuan, who ruled until 783 BC, wrongfully had his minister executed, the ghost returned to get revenge and killed the leader with a bow and arrow. Today, millions of people around the world believe ghosts do exist in one form or another. Belief or non-belief, however, doesn’t change their popularity as great Halloween invitations ideas.

A Vampire for the Halloween Invitation

Vampires are one of the most popular of all the scary monsters that supposedly lurk in the night. Adding one to invitations for Halloween gatherings might just increase the attendance at the party, especially with the ladies. Like ghosts, vampires have been a popular legend for centuries. Even the earliest human civilizations in the world supposedly believed in the existence of creatures similar to those of the vampire. But most of the scary Halloween invitations feature the vampire of Eastern European origins whose stories date back to at least the early 18th century. But the vampire didn’t become the enticing gentleman popularized in Western culture until 1819’s “The Vampyre” and 1897’s Dracula. The latter was also influenced by the stories about Vlad the Impaler, a real Transylvanian ruler who did many unspeakable things to those he felt had wronged him.

Halloween Party Invitation for the Witch

Like ghosts, witches are very commonly associated with Halloween ideas, including costumes. Witches, like ghosts and vampires, have a long history with the human race, even pre-dating the ancient celebrations of this holiday. Witches are a complex subject because the term can refer to the people wrongly accused of the crime then tortured or killed during witch hunts like the ones in Salem and all over the world, to folk medicine practitioners who used herbal medicine to heal people as if by magic, to pagan nature worshippers, or to people who use magic and spells to control people, the environment, and the world. Although witches have been depicted in many ways throughout different cultures, the modern Western view likely to appear on free Halloween invitations was probably shaped by the appearance of the Wicked Witch of the West in the Wizard of Oz film from 1939.
